What is Rackspace Technology, Inc.'s finite lived intangible assets - gross?
Rackspace Technology, Inc. (RXT) reported finite lived intangible assets - gross of $1.96B in Q1 2026.
How has Rackspace Technology, Inc.'s finite lived intangible assets - gross changed year-over-year?
Rackspace Technology, Inc.'s finite lived intangible assets - gross increased by 0.1% year-over-year, from $1.96B to $1.96B.
What is the long-term trend for Rackspace Technology, Inc.'s finite lived intangible assets - gross?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Rackspace Technology, Inc.'s finite lived intangible assets - gross has grown at a -0.9%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$2.05B to $1.96B.
What does finite lived intangible assets - gross mean?
This metric tracks the total historical cost of intangible assets that have a defined useful life, such as patents, software licenses, or customer relationships. It excludes assets with indefinite lives like certain trademarks or goodwill. It is a key indicator of the company's investment in intellectual property and intangible competitive advantages.
